Graduate school is an important and confusing time, filled with many questions about the process and decisions that students must make. From Orientation to the Tenure-Track: The Grad Student Guidebook offers an overview of this experience, featuring expert advice on the many different steps and challenges that students encounter in their time as master’s and doctoral students. Written in a conversational style, the chapters integrate advice, encouragement, and anecdotes to address specific components of the graduate school process.
